My phantom 3 pro camera rocks back and forth along the horizon. I've done 14 IMU calibrations up to this point, all followed by a gimbal calibration. I can make it stop by hand but once I'm airborne whenever the aircraft moves to the right it twitches and rock back and forth again and need to bring it back and land it to make it stop by hand. It has the latest firmware and was installed correctly. What am I missing??
